  • Patent number: 5896374
    Abstract: A variable rate transmission method that can vary the transmission rate of data. A transmitting side supplies a transmitted data sequence to an error detecting encoder 105 and a frame memory 103. The frame memory 103 stores data of a variable length to be transmitted in one frame. The error detecting encoder 105 calculates an error detecting code (such as CRC code) for each frame of the transmitted data. A multiplexer 104 adds the calculated error detecting code ahead of the transmitted data to place it at the initial position of the frame, and sequentially outputs the data sequence frame by frame. A receiving side calculates an error detecting code of the data in each transmitted frame in the same manner as the transmitting side, and compares the calculated error detecting code with the error detecting code at the initial position of the frame. The end bit of the frame data is decided as a position at which the two error detecting codes coincide.

  • Patent number: 5869278
    Abstract: Mature Human Growth Hormone is prepared by enzymatic hydrolysis of a soluble precursor with immobilized Factor Xa. The soluble precursor contains a cleavage recognition sequence, Ile--Glu--Gly--Arg, for Factor Xa. The Factor Xa is preferably immobilized on CNBr activated Sepharose Cl-4B containing cyclic imido carbonate groups. Immobilization is carried out by reaction of amine groups on Factor X with the cyclic imido carbonate groups of the CNBr activated Sepharose Cl-4B to form covalently immobilized Factor X, which is then activated to Factor Xa with a protein contained in Russell's viper venom (RVV) in the presence of Ca.sup.++ ions.
